Samuel Pollock
  Co-Chief Executive Offier


Sam is Managing Partner of Brookfield Asset Management and Co-Chief Executive Officer of Brookfield's infrastructure group. Sam has been responsible for the expansion of Brookfield’s infrastructure operating platform. Under Sam’s leadership, Brookfield has built its timber platform over the past five years from a modest operation of 400,000 acres under management in 2002 to the fifth largest in North America with more than 2.5 million acres under management. Sam has also acted as Brookfield’s Chief Investment Officer, leading privatizations such as the $9 billion privatization of Trizec Properties Inc. and the $2 billion acquisition of O&Y Canada. Sam is a Chartered Accountant and holds a business degree from Queen’s University.
 
Aaron Regent
  Co-Chief Executive Offier

 

Aaron is Managing Partner of Brookfield Asset Management and Co-Chief Executive Officer of Brookfield's infrastructure group.  Prior to re-joining Brookfield Asset Management in September 2006, Aaron was President and Chief Executive Officer of Falconbridge Limited prior to its merger with Noranda Inc. in 2005. Following the merger with Noranda, Aaron became the President of the new company, which was subsequently sold to Xstrata PLC for C$27 billion. Before moving to Falconbridge, Aaron held senior executive positions in several Brookfield affiliates, including Executive Vice-President and Chief Financial Officer of Noranda Inc., President and Chief Executive Officer of Trilon Securities Corporation and Senior Vice-President and Chief Financial Officer of Brascan Corporation, now known as Brookfield Asset Management. In 2000, he was recognized as one of Canada’s Top 40 Under 40 and in 2005 as one of the Top 40 over the past ten years. Aaron holds a Bachelor of Arts degree from the University of Western Ontario.
 
John Stinebaugh
  Chief Financial Officer

 

John is a Managing Partner with Brookfield Asset Management and Chief Financial Officer of Brookfield's infrastructure group. He is responsible for business development for Brookfield’s energy infrastructure business, focusing on acquisitions of energy infrastructure assets in North America and other jurisdictions. Prior to that, John was with Credit Suisse Securities (U.S.A.) LLC where he worked in the energy group with responsibility for mergers and acquisitions and leveraged financings. During his tenure at Brookfield Asset Management and Credit Suisse, John worked on announced acquisitions and divestitures of energy infrastructure companies in excess of $15 billion. John received his Chartered Financial Analyst designation in 1995 and graduated with a degree in economics from Harvard University.
